This is a list of NDS games supporting multiplayer. Note that many games only support a limited version of the game for download play, and you might still need to play with several game carts to get all multiplayer options!
| Game name | Download Play | Multicart | Online Wi-Fi |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Advance Wars: Dual Strike | 2-8 players | 2-8 players | - | Download play only features a demo of the "Combat mode" |
| Animal Crossing: Wild World | - | 2-4 players | Yes | |
| Big Brain Academy | 2-8 players | 2-8 players | - | |
| Bleach |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| Yes | |
| Bleach 2nd |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| Yes | |
| Bomberman | 2-8 players | - | - | Only one game cart is needed for full multiplayer functionality |
| Brain Age | 2-16 players | - | - | Calculation battle is the only multiplayer game |
| Burnout Legends | 2-4 players | ? | - | |
| Children of Mana | - | 2-4 players | - | |
| Club House Games | 2-4 players | 2-7 players | Yes | |
| Elite Beat Agents |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| - | Only 5 songs on Download Play, all songs on multicart |
| Final Fantasy Crystal Chronicles: Ring of Fates | - | 2-4 players | Yes | |
| Jump Super Stars |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| - | |
| Jump Ultimate Stars |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| Yes | If you wish to have the best experience in Wi-fi, use Friend Codes to set up matches. |
| Mario Kart DS | 2-8 players | 2-8 players | Yes | |
| Mario Party DS | - | 2-4 players | - | |
| Meteos |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| - | |
| Metroid Prime Hunters |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| Yes | |
| New Super Mario Bros |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| - | Mario vs Luigi: 2 players, minigames: 2-4 players |
| Osu! Tatake! Ouendan | - | 2-4 players | - | You can send the tutorial over download play, but there is no single-card multiplayer. |
| Pokémon Diamond Version | - | 2-16 players | Yes | Communication capacity depends on activity |
| Pokémon Pearl Version | - | 2-16 players | Yes | Communication capacity depends on activity |
| Picross DS | - | 2 players | Yes | New content downloadable from WiFi |
| Puyo Pop Fever | 2-8 players | 2-8 players | - | |
| Sega Casino | - | 2-4 players | - | |
| Space Invaders Extreme | 2 players | 2 players | Yes | Wi-fi is for ranking and head-to-head. |
| Super Monkey Ball - Touch and Roll | 2-4 players | 2-4 players | - | Single Card has only 3 mini-games available |
| Tetris | 2-10 players | 2-10 players | Yes | Standard mode: 2-10 players, push mode: 2 players |
| The Legend of Zelda: Phantom Hourglass | 2 players | 2 players | Yes | |
| Yugioh: World Championship 2007 | - | 2 players | Yes | Wi-Fi mode allows you to duel around the world, and to download new content (Forbidden/limited card lists, New Puzzles) |
